Building a Skincare Routine for Latin American Climates
Latin America's diverse climates demand adaptable skincare. Here's how to build a routine that works. ## Tropical & Humid (Brazil, Caribbean, Coastal) - **Cleanse** with a gel or foaming cleanser twice daily - **Treat** with lightweight niacinamide serums to control oil - **Moisturize** with oil-free, gel textures - **SPF 50+** is non-negotiable, reapply every 2 hours ## High Altitude (Mexico City, Bogotá, La Paz) - **Hydrate** with richer creams containing hyaluronic acid - **Barrier repair** with ceramides and squalane - **SPF** is critical — UV is 40-60% stronger at altitude ## Desert & Dry (Northern Mexico, Peru coast) - **Cream or oil cleansers** to preserve lipids - **Face oils** like rosehip to lock in moisture - **Overnight masks** 2-3 times per week Our Rosehip Renewal Face Oil works beautifully across all these climates — it's lightweight enough for humidity yet nourishing enough for dry air.
